(i) Unless the Company has elected to defer such payment as provided in Section 7.6(c)(iii), each Member that holds a Preferred Interest shall be entitled on each Preferred Payment Date to a mandatory Distribution in cash (a "Preferred Mandatory Payment") equal to the sum of (A) 9.5% per annum (the "Preferred Distribution Rate") of the Preferred Contribution of such Member and (B) if any Preferred Mandatory Payments payable to such Member are not paid in full on the date they are due (or would be due but for (1) the Cash Earnings Limitation set forth in the last sentence of this Section 7.6(c)(i) or (2) a deferral of Preferred Mandatory Payments pursuant to Section 7.6(c)(iii)) (such unpaid amounts, together with any accruals thereon pursuant to this Section 7.6(c)(i)(B), the "Amounts Past Due"), the Preferred Distribution Rate (plus 0.5% per annum) of the Amounts Past Due, compounded semi-annually (to the extent permitted by Law). If the Company has insufficient positive Cash Earnings to pay an entire Preferred Mandatory Payment, Amounts Past Due required to be paid pursuant to this Section 7.6(c)(i) shall have preference over and be paid before other amounts required to be paid pursuant to this Section 7.6(c)(i) (other than any Preferred Tax Amount). Except as set forth in Section 7.6(c)(iv), a Preferred Mandatory Payment is payable out of positive Cash Earnings for the semi-annual period preceding the relevant Preferred Payment Date (the "Cash Earnings Limitation"), but any unpaid amount shall be considered an "Amount Past Due" in accordance with clause (B) of the preceding sentence and shall be due and payable on the next Preferred Payment Date (subject to the Cash Earnings Limitation for such date). (ii) Preferred Mandatory Payments on the Preferred Interest of a Member (A) will be cumulative; (B) will accumulate from the most recent date on which the entire accrued and unpaid Preferred Mandatory Payments have been paid or, if no Preferred Mandatory Payments have been paid, from and including the date of the First Amendment, to but excluding the earliest of (1) the related Preferred Payment Date, (2) the date of repayment or redemption of the Preferred Interest and (3) August 15, 2030; and (C) will be payable semi-annually in arrears on June 30 and December 31 of each year, commencing on December 31, 2000, except to the extent any such payment is deferred as described below, and on the Preferred Mandatory Redemption Date; and (D) will be paid prior to the Company making any Distribution pursuant to Section 7.6(a)(ii). The amount of any Preferred Mandatory Payment payable for any period will be computed on the basis of a 360-day year consisting of twelve 30-day months and for any period of less than a full calendar month on the basis of the actual number of days elapsed in such month. If any date on which Preferred Mandatory Payments are payable is not a Business Day, then payment of the amount payable on such date shall be made on the next succeeding day that is a Business Day (and without any -7- 8 interest or other payment in respect of any such delay), except that, if such Business Day is in the next succeeding calendar year, such payment shall be made on the immediately preceding Business Day, in each case with the same force and effect as if made on the date such payment was originally payable (each date on which a Preferred Mandatory Payment is payable (or would be payable but for (1) the Cash Earnings Limitation set forth in the last sentence of Section 7.6(c)(i) or (2) a deferral pursuant to Section 7.6(c)(iii)) in accordance with the foregoing, a "Preferred Payment Date"). (iii) The Company shall have the right to defer the payment of Preferred Mandatory Payments (other than the Preferred Tax Amount) by extending the payment period at any time and from time to time for a period (each an "Extension Period") not exceeding 10 consecutive semi-annual periods, including the first such semi-annual period during such Extension Period; provided, however, that no Extension Period shall extend beyond the Preferred Mandatory Redemption Date. Preferred Mandatory Payments (other than the Preferred Tax Amount) will be deferred during any Extension Period. Notwithstanding such deferral, during any Extension Period, Preferred Mandatory Payments in arrears shall continue to accumulate additional amounts thereon (to the extent permitted by Law), as provided in Section 7.6(c)(i). Prior to the expiration of any Extension Period, the Company may further defer payments by further extending such Extension Period; provided, however, that such Extension Period, together with all previous and further extensions, if any, within such Extension Period, may not (A) exceed 10 consecutive semi-annual periods, including the first semi-annual period during such Extension Period, or (B) extend beyond the Preferred Mandatory Redemption Date. Upon the expiration of any Extension Period (or any extension thereof) and the payment of all amounts then due, the Company may commence a new Extension Period, subject to the above requirements. There is no limitation on the number of times that the Company may elect to begin an Extension Period; provided, however, that during any such Extension Period, no Distributions (other than tax distributions as set forth in Section 7.6(a)(i) and Section 7.6(c)(iv)) may be made to any Member. (iv) On each Preferred Payment Date during any Extension Period (and on each Preferred Payment Date on which the limitations set forth in the last sentence of Section 7.6(c)(i) would otherwise apply), the Company shall distribute to each Preferred Member a portion of the Preferred Mandatory Payment that otherwise would be due and payable on such date (the "Preferred Tax Amount") equal to the greater of (A) the product of (I) the sum of the maximum United States regular Federal income tax rate applicable to C corporations under Section 11 of the Code and 4.5 percent and (II) the excess, if any, of taxable income and gain over taxable loss or deduction of the Company allocated to such Preferred Member with respect to such period and (B) (x) such Preferred Member's Percentage Interest in the Company multiplied by the quotient of (y) the amount calculated under -8- 9 clause (A) with respect to such period for the other Preferred Member (or Preferred Members) (the "Other Preferred Member") divided by (z) the Other Preferred Member's Percentage Interest in the Company. Such Distributions shall be made in a manner consistent with the estimated annual tax items of the Company, and Distributions pursuant to this clause (iv) for each semi-annual accounting period (or portion thereof) shall be adjusted to the extent Distributions for prior semi-annual accounting periods did not correctly estimate such items.
